Detailed insights for CB9 0BQ

Overview

Postcode CB9 0BQ is located in an urban city, within the Haverhill Central ward of West Suffolk in the East of England region, and forms part of the Haverhill East & South area. It has high deprivation and high crime levels, with around 88 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, in line with the East of England average of 82 per 1,000. The average income per household in Haverhill East & South is £50,617 per year. The nearest station is Dullingham, about 8.6 miles away. There are 7 primary and 2 secondary schools in the area. There is 1 park nearby, the closest medium park is Haverhill Recreation Ground.
